A Penguin’s Appearance and Peculiar Ways
Appearance
Gunter, at first glance, presents a familiar image: a small, round penguin. He’s primarily black and white, with a prominent orange beak and small, beady eyes. His appearance is undeniably cute, fitting seamlessly into the colorful world of Adventure Time.
Behavior
However, it’s Gunter’s behavior that truly sets him apart. He rarely speaks in coherent sentences, instead resorting to a high-pitched, squawking sound that is often the source of both amusement and unease. His frequent exclamation “Wenk!” is a hallmark of his personality.
Obsessions
Gunter displays several peculiar obsessions, most notably with eggs. He is frequently seen stealing, hoarding, and consuming them with a ravenous appetite. His fondness for eggs is more than just a dietary preference; it’s a recurring element that underscores his enigmatic nature. This seemingly simple quirk contributes to the overall unsettling quality of his character.
Duality
The contrast between Gunter’s innocent appearance and his often disturbing actions creates a unique and compelling dynamic. He can appear utterly harmless one moment and then unleash a hidden, potentially destructive side the next. This duality makes him one of the most fascinating characters in Adventure Time.
The Bond with the Ice King
Relationship Dynamics
Gunter’s relationship with the Ice King is central to his character. Their bond is a strange and often co-dependent one. The Ice King, a lonely and somewhat pathetic figure, views Gunter as his loyal pet and confidant. He showers Gunter with affection, often unaware of the manipulation and potential danger that the penguin embodies.
Manipulation
Gunter, in turn, seems to exploit the Ice King’s vulnerabilities. He constantly demands attention, resources, and control, often with an unnervingly casual ruthlessness. The Ice King is easily swayed by Gunter’s desires, granting him the freedom to act as he pleases. This power dynamic reveals a disturbing side of Gunter’s personality.
Humor and Tragedy
The Ice King’s oblivious nature contributes to the humor and tragedy that defines their relationship. We see the Ice King’s genuine affection for Gunter, his desire for companionship, and the utter lack of awareness of the danger he harbors within his own castle. This creates a tragic irony in the Ice King’s life. Gunter, the creature he trusts the most, is also potentially the one most likely to cause his downfall.
